What is a Single Integrated Oven?
A single integrated oven is a built-in cooking appliance created to be perfectly integrated into kitchen cabinets. Unlike traditional freestanding ovens, single integrated ovens are particularly crafted for a smooth, space-saving impact without extending into the kitchen design. This makes them an attractive alternative for contemporary kitchens where visual appeals and company are essential.

There are a number of types of single integrated ovens readily available, each customized to particular cooking requirements:
Conventional Ovens: Great for conventional baking and roasting.Convection Ovens: Feature fans that distribute hot air for even cooking.Microwave Ovens: Combine microwave heating with a baking function.Steam Ovens: Use steam to cook food, keeping wetness and nutrients.Combination Ovens: Offer functions of both convection and steam cooking.Selecting the Right Single Integrated Oven

FAQs About Single Integrated Ovens1. How do I clean a single integrated oven?
A lot of single integrated ovens feature self-cleaning alternatives. However, for manual cleansing, it is advisable to utilize a non-abrasive cleaner and prevent severe chemicals that can harm the appliance's surface.
2. Can you prepare several meals at the same time?
Yes, lots of single integrated ovens, especially convection models, allow for multi-level cooking. However, make sure that the dishes don't have conflicting cooking times or temperatures for optimum results.
3. What's the average expense of a single integrated oven?
The price of single integrated ovens differs widely based on features and brand, ranging from ₤ 800 to over ₤ 3,000. It is necessary to compare models and ensure they satisfy cooking requirements within spending plan limitations.
4. Are single integrated ovens energy effective?
Generally, single integrated ovens are developed to be more energy-efficient than traditional ovens, typically featuring energy-saving modes and insulation to preserve temperature.
5. Can I install a single integrated oven myself?
While installation may appear straightforward, it is advised to work with a professional for electrical and plumbing connections to make sure safety and compliance with regional policies.
